The Hyderabad city traffic police have taken a pretty big decision with regard to the traffic and roadway adjustment that has been made at the KBR Road in Banjara Hills. This is a pretty big decision taken by the traffic authority is considering the importance of this road in Hyderabad commute.

The oneway arrangement that has been made at the KBR Park has not opened to a good response from the public as there is a lot of backlash happening on the same.

The first day of turning the entire five-kilometer KBR Park road into a one-way route by the Hyderabad Traffic Police witnessed slowdowns at the main roads despite communications and several cops being around. Largely due to the fact that the commuters struggled to adapt to the new system.

The KBR Park road that connects to Hitech City, Gachibowli and Film Nagar via Jubilee Hills Road No 45 usually witnesses high traffic in the morning from around 9.30 am onwards till noon, which is peak office rush hour.

With both sides now becoming one-way, there was a bigger slowdown than usual as commuters who missed signboards were seen crossing lanes to reach their destination.

Many software engineers who usually travel on this road are complaining about extreme delay in the traffic moment and are saying that a journey that usually goes on for 20 minutes is now taking one hour.

It is now the responsibility of the traffic authorities to make sure that the situation gets resolved at the earliest. But at the same time, the public must also be understanding of the situation as the underpass that is under construction is going to be a crucial step towards regulating the traffic here.
